**Mgmt Meeting Minutes — Retiring the Brightline Range**

Quick recap for sales leads at Fenholt Supplies: we agreed to retire the Brightline fixture range by year-end. Remaining stock moves to clearance pricing next month, and accounts on standing orders get migrated to the Lumetta range. Trade-in incentives were approved in principle. The confidential note on next steps sits just below.

board note of bajof-bajeg: The pricing group signed off on a budget of $13.4 million for Project Sildor. The renewal with Lamixek Holdings closes at $48.9 million a year, 49 percent above the last contract.

**Onboarding: Replica Lag Alarm (Team Millbrace)**

The Oakendale reporting database uses two read replicas. The lag alarm fires when replication delay exceeds 90 seconds, usually during the nightly Fennick import. First response: check the import job status, then confirm replica health on the Millbrace dashboard. Do not fail over for transient spikes under five minutes. To query the alarm service directly, authenticate with the key below.

gateway credential: kto3_qfe

Finance Review Summary — Heads of Department

Re: Proposed franchise agreement with Orvington Foods Group

The draft agreement grants Orvington exclusive rights across the Calder Valley region for five years, with royalty payments of 5.5% on gross sales and a fixed onboarding fee. Legal review cleared the territory clauses last week. The strategic intent behind this arrangement is noted below.

board note of baweg-bawig: Project Tamath slips by six weeks because of the audit delay.